CSVからTSVへの変換ツール
CSV(カンマ区切り値)をTSV(タブ区切り値)に変換
CSVデータ入力
データファイルを扱っていると、異なるフォーマット間で変換が必要になる場面に遭遇することがよくありますよね。CSV to TSV 変換ツールを使えば、カンマ区切り値(CSV)ファイルをタブ区切り値(TSV)ファイルに数秒で変換できて、とても簡単です。スプレッドシートデータ、データベースエクスポート、データ分析プロジェクトなど、どんな場面でも、信頼できる変換ツールがあれば時間を節約でき、手動でのフォーマット変更の手間から解放されます。
CSV to TSV 変換ツールとは?
CSV to TSV 変換ツールは、CSVファイルをTSVフォーマットに変換する専用のユーティリティです。CSVファイルはカンマでデータフィールドを区切りますが、TSVファイルはタブを区切り文字として使用します。小さな違いに見えるかもしれませんが、特定のアプリケーション、データベース、またはタブ区切りファイルを必要とするプログラミング環境にデータをインポートする際には、この違いが重要になります。
変換プロセスは技術的な詳細をすべて自動的に処理します。CSVの構造を読み取り、カンマの区切り文字を識別し、データの整合性を保ちながらタブ文字に置き換えます。つまり、行、列、セルの値はそのまま維持され、区切り文字のフォーマットだけが変わるということです。
CSV to TSV 変換ツールを使う理由
開発者やデータ専門家がCSV to TSV変換ツールを使う理由はいくつかあります:
- アプリケーション互換性:多くのデータベースシステム、データ分析ツール、プログラミングライブラリは、特にデータの値自体にカンマが含まれている場合、TSVファイルの方がうまく動作します。
- データ整合性:TSVフォーマットは、カンマ、引用符、特殊文字を含むテキストフィールドがある場合に、CSVパーサーを混乱させる可能性のある解析エラーを減らします。
- スピードと効率:手動変換は面倒でエラーが発生しやすいです。自動変換ツールなら、数千行あっても瞬時に処理できます。
- クリーンなデータ処理:プロフェッショナルな変換ツールは、特殊文字を適切にエスケープし、手動変換では壊れてしまう可能性のあるエッジケースにも対応します。
CSV to TSV 変換の一般的な使用例
CSV to TSV 変換ツールが必要になるシーンは様々です。データサイエンティストは、数値フォーマットにカンマを使用する国際的なデータセットを扱う際、RやPython pandasなどの分析フレームワークにインポートする前にファイルを変換することがよくあります。データベース管理者は、PostgreSQL、MySQL、その他のタブ区切り入力を好むデータベースシステムへの一括インポートにTSVファイルを使用します。
Web開発者は、eコマースプラットフォームやCMSシステムからのデータエクスポートを、サーバーサイドスクリプトで処理するためにTSVフォーマットに変換することがよくあります。ログファイル、設定データ、または異なるシステム間で移動する必要がある構造化テキストを扱っている場合、フォーマット変換はワークフローの中で定期的なタスクになります。
CSV to TSV 変換ツールの仕組み
CSV to TSV 変換ツールの使い方は簡単です。CSVファイルのコンテンツをアップロードまたは貼り付けるだけで、ツールが即座に処理します。裏側では、変換ツールがCSVファイルの各行を解析し、フィールド区切り文字を識別して、カンマの代わりにタブ文字を使用してデータ構造を再構築します。
注目すべき主な機能
高品質なCSV to TSV変換ツールには、いくつかの重要な機能が必要です:
- 自動区切り文字検出:セミコロン区切りやパイプ区切りの値など、異なるCSVフォーマットをスマートに認識します。
- ヘッダー行の処理:データ構造を維持するために列ヘッダーを適切に処理します。
- 文字エンコーディングサポート:UTF-8、ASCII、その他の文字エンコーディングを特殊文字を破損させることなく処理します。
- プレビュー機能:完全なファイルをダウンロードする前に、変換された出力のサンプルを確認できます。
- バッチ処理:大規模なプロジェクトのために複数のファイルを一度に変換できます。
当社のCSV to TSV 変換ツールを使うメリット
信頼性の高いファイル変換が必要な時、プロフェッショナルなCSV to TSV 変換ツールにアクセスできれば、推測や技術的な複雑さから解放されます。変換はブラウザ内で即座に行われ、機密データを外部サーバーにアップロードする必要がないため、プライバシーとデータセキュリティが保たれます。インポート用のデータ準備、互換性の問題の修正、プロジェクト全体でのファイルフォーマットの標準化など、どんな場面でも、このツールはワークフローを効率化し、最も重要なこと、つまりファイルフォーマットと格闘するのではなく、データを扱うことに集中できるようにします。